"Seeing is believing!" - This timeless saying rings true in various areas of our existence, yet in the realm of data interpretation, direct visual inspection does not suffice. TissueGnostics counteracts this drawback with its innovative Tissue Image Cytometers, utilizing a full-spectrum approach to elucidate the molecular processes behind health conditions like cancerous conditions, immunological disorders, and pathogenic diseases.

Since 2003, TissueGnostics has emerged as a global frontrunner, driving biomedical research in over 60 nations across all continents. Their offerings have been highlighted in thousands of studies and published in more than 800 peer-reviewed journals, facilitating global research in their quest to decipher the origins of disease formation and develop solutions for patients.

The innovations and solutions from TissueGnostics are key in propelling precision medicine, aiming to benefit a vast number of patients globally. The multicultural team at TissueGnostics is unwaveringly committed to their brand mantra - Precision that Inspires!.

Broader Economic and Social Implications
The sweeping impacts stemming from digital pathology go beyond the boundaries of clinical laboratories.

From an economic standpoint, the switch from traditional to digital pathology is reshaping healthcare costs along with financial resource management.

Through reducing the requisite time for slide evaluation by limiting curtailing misdiagnoses, digital pathology offers meaningful budgetary savings relative to healthcare institutions. The financial gains thereby can be channeled for research efforts and clinical care, producing a positive feedback loop of innovation and improved outcomes.


On a societal level, the merging of virtual medical pathology is capable of equalize access to reach within high-quality diagnostic services.

Remote in addition to resource-poor areas, in regions where connection concerning specialist diagnosticians is restricted, are positioned to benefit greatly from online pathology services. Digital visuals are communicated through expansive spaces, allowing virtual remote medical consultations coupled with ensuring that individuals obtain professional diagnoses regardless whether the individual’s regional position. The broadening of professional reach is particularly significant at a time since differences in patient care are widespread an urgent matter.

Furthermore, the digital data yielded with digital clinical pathology provides extensive avenues in the realm of epidemiologic research together with public health projects campaigns. Substantial data arrays which capture delicate alterations in biological form supplies indications regarding illness patterns, treatment success, furthermore moreover contextual factors determining disease outcomes. In such a context, TissueGnostics’ application serves not merely as a diagnostic tool but also accelerates societal gains.

Looking Ahead: Opportunities and Challenges
While the digital pathology field advances, TissueGnostics confronts both potentials and difficulties as it advances. The assimilation of future analytics, scalable cloud-based offerings together with seamless connectivity relative to diverse digital health systems represent promising avenues for innovation. These progressive changes are set to further improve procedural workflows along with unveil fresh opportunities within research and diagnostic arenas.

Even so, there are barriers to overcome. Continuous education and skill updating is crucial since clinicians acclimate to digital tools. Ensuring that histopathologists and laboratory professionals feel at ease with digital technologies is essential for the success of the digital transition. This need is recognized by TissueGnostics and dedicates resources to detailed training solutions combined with user support systems aimed at easing an effortless shift from old methods to digital systems.

A new hurdle pertains to maintaining harmony linking modern technology with the know-how of practitioners. Despite the benefits, automated technologies and digital innovations have the potential to considerably elevate accuracy in diagnosis, they are not meant to replace but rather serve as auxiliary to the manual expertise of skilled experts. Ensuring this harmony TissueGnostics will be critical with the continuous evolution of digital pathology as it increasingly depends on data-centric evaluations.

As we look forward, the opportunity to collaborate globally is a highly promising prospect for TissueGnostics and the international digital pathology community. By forging partnerships with research organizations, treatment centers, coupled with leading companies, the company is set to push forward the future of innovation. These partnerships will not only accelerate the pace of technological advancement while ensuring worldwide access to digital pathology.
